Summary

Panama Canal Act Amendments of 1989 - Amends the Panama Canal Act of 1979 to set at a daily rate equivalent to level V of the Executive Schedule the compensation of members of the Supervisory Board of the Panama Canal Commission who hold no office with the governments of either the United States or Panama. Authorizes payment of the overseas recruitment or retention differential provided for in the Act to the Deputy Administrator and Chief Engineer of the Commission, if eligible. Provides for eligibility for and computation of retirement annuities for Commission employees. Prohibits the Commission from obligating or expending funds for construction of the Gaillard Cut widening project unless specifically authorized by law enacted after enactment of this Act.
